Ganimete Musliu, Member of Parliament from the Democratic Party of Kosovo (PDK), criticized the Democratic League of Kosovo (LDK) for what she called indecisiveness and lack of political courage.
Commenting on recent political developments, Musliu accused LDK of contributing to deepening the political crisis in Kosovo.
“They neither dare to stand with Albin Kurti nor with us,” said Musliu, adding that the party consistently avoids taking clear positions, which has held Kosovo back.
She emphasized that strong leadership and maturity are necessary to navigate the current political uncertainty and mentioned that PDK will announce its official stance following a meeting of the party’s presidency.
